**Ticket: Config drift on Mosaica tile cache (staging vs prod)**

During the pre-release audit I found that the staging tile-rendering cache for Mosaica has diverged from production in eviction policy and shard count. This likely explains the inconsistent hit-rate numbers Dalia flagged last week. Before we cut the release, please confirm which environment is canonical. The values currently running in production are reproduced below.

service settings:
[silwyn]
host = silwyn.crelvogrid.internal
user = silwyn_svc
database = silwyn_prod

Subject: Dependency pinning — ownership change

Effective Monday, dependency pinning policy for the Larkspur monorepo moves out of the platform rotation. All version bumps go through the new pinning review queue; no direct edits to lockfiles on main. Exceptions require a written waiver, 48-hour turnaround. The old #pinning-triage channel is archived. Questions about transitive pins or the quarterly refresh cadence go to one owner from now on. That owner is named below.

named custodian: Brivan Eliath Quenox Frador

This page covers break-glass access for blue-green deploys of the Ledgerline billing worker. Under normal conditions, the Greenlight pipeline flips traffic automatically after health checks pass on the idle color. If the pipeline stalls mid-flip and billing events begin queuing, the release manager may bypass automation via the emergency console. Document the reason in the deploy log before proceeding, and notify the Ledgerline owners channel afterward. To unlock the emergency console, enter the recovery passphrase shown immediately below.

recovery phrase for bawep-kawef: oliath-casdor

## Releases

Welcome to Quenchalert, our on-call alert deduplicator. Releases happen biweekly: we branch from `main`, run the replay harness against last month's alert archive, and confirm no regressions in suppression accuracy. New team members should shadow one release before cutting their own. Each release bundle must be signed before upload; the current release key is:

rollout seal: bky4_x7Gc